What are the biggest highlights in your riding career?
Being shortlisted for the 2012 London Olympics on "F1 Pharinelli", winning Adelaide 3* on Warrego Marco Polo, and winning the inaugural Scone Ellerston 4* riding KPH Kingfisher.

What Pryde's EasiFeed products do you use and how do they help meet the needs of both you as an owner/rider and your horses?
I have been feeding Pryde's EasiRide for as long as I've been riding professionally - I love this feed as a staple, for high level competition horses right through to green youngsters and horses off the track. They do so well on it, and they love it. For those in 3DE work, I add EasiResult and EnergyPak, which keeps them feeling energetic and fresh even in heavy work.
